poppy is helping clean up a park.her group is cleaning 2/5 of park. another group is cleaning 1/4 of the park. how much should of the park should third group clean? math problem solved

Final answer:

The third group should clean 0.35 (or 35%) of the park.

Step-by-step explanation:

To find out how much the third group should clean, we need to subtract the amount cleaned by the first two groups from the total. The first group cleaned 2/5 (or 0.4) of the park, and the second group cleaned 1/4 (or 0.25) of the park. Therefore, the total amount cleaned by the first two groups is 0.4 + 0.25 = 0.65. To find out how much the third group should clean, we subtract 0.65 from 1 (since 1 represents the whole park). So, the third group should clean 1 - 0.65 = 0.35 (or 35%) of the park.
